More Than Just Noise Control
Acoustic fencing is designed with dense, overlapping panels that minimise airborne sound transmission. However, its construction also lends itself to a host of secondary benefits.
Security Without Compromising Style
The thick, robust structure of acoustic fencing naturally deters intruders. Unlike standard wooden panels, these fences are built with height, density, and strength in mind.
Security features include:
- High resistance to impact and tampering
- Fewer gaps or footholds for climbing
- Long-lasting protection with minimal wear
You get both a visual and physical barrier — ideal for households that value privacy and peace of mind.

Enhancing Outdoor Comfort
For families in Upwell who enjoy spending time in their gardens, acoustic fencing brings more than quiet—it creates a calm, controlled space.
Lifestyle benefits:
- Reduces wind flow into the garden area
- Acts as a barrier to dust and debris
- Helps retain heat in outdoor spaces
It can turn a previously uncomfortable garden into a more usable outdoor living space, especially for homes near roads, railways, or commercial activity.
Better Privacy Without Gaps
Another major selling point is the privacy offered by the design of acoustic fencing. The close-fitting, overlapping boards offer no visual access.
Perfect for:
- Urban homes overlooked by neighbours
- Gardens next to public walkways or footpaths
- Families looking to create secluded outdoor areas
This level of visual privacy, combined with sound reduction, offers a dual-purpose solution that’s hard to beat.
Low Maintenance, Long-Term Value
While many assume acoustic fencing is high-maintenance, the opposite is true. Properly installed systems are built for longevity with minimal upkeep required.
Maintenance and durability benefits:
- Pressure-treated timber resists rot and insects
- Sturdy posts minimise warping and sagging
- Occasional staining or sealing keeps it looking new
This adds value to your property and saves time in the long run, especially when professionally fitted and installed.
